Can lawyers use AI while respecting professional ethics?
Yes, under two conditions: human control at all times and tools compliant with GDPR and professional secrecy. A solution that cites the source makes that control immediate.
Does AI replace the lawyer?
No. It removes research and repetitive work, but the decision always stays yours.
